2 Calculating density

3 Measuring density: 1 Find out the mass of each object with an electronic balance. Calculating density

4 2 Find out the volume of each object with a measuring cylinder. Calculating density

5 3 Calculate the density of each object: Density = Density = Mass Volume Calculating density

6 Why does a fresh egg sink in water? Why does it sink? Because its density is higher than water. How can we make the egg float? Increase the density of the liquid. Calculating density

7 Measure 18 g table salt with an electronic balance. Then add the salt into 200 cm 3 water. Calculating density

8 Density of water without salt: 1 g/cm 3 Density of water with salt: Mass of 200 cm 3 water = 200 g Mass of salt = 18 g Mass of salt water = 200 g + 18 g = 218 g Volume of salt water = 200 cm 3 Density of salt water = 218 g  200 = 1.09 g/cm 3 The egg floats!!! Calculating density
